File indexing completed on 2024-04-06 12:01:43
0001 import FWCore.ParameterSet.Config as cms
0002
0003 process = cms.Process("TEST")
0004 process.load("CondCore.DBCommon.CondDBCommon_cfi")
0005 process.CondDBCommon.connect = 'sqlite_file:pop_test.db'
0006 process.CondDBCommon.DBParameters.messageLevel = cms.untracked.int32(3)
0007
0008 process.eff = cms.ESSource("PoolDBESSource",
0009 process.CondDBCommon,
0010 RefreshEachRun=cms.untracked.bool(True),
0011 DumpStat=cms.untracked.bool(True),
0012 toGet = cms.VPSet(
0013 cms.PSet(
0014 record = cms.string('ExEfficiencyRcd'),
0015 label = cms.untracked.string('vinEff1'),
0016 tag = cms.string('Example_tag1')
0017 ),
0018 cms.PSet(
0019 record = cms.string('ExEfficiencyRcd'),
0020 label = cms.untracked.string('vinEff2'),
0021 tag = cms.string('Example_tag2')
0022 )
0023 )
0024 )
0025
0026
0027
0028
0029
0030
0031
0032
0033 process.source = cms.Source("EmptySource",
0034 firstLuminosityBlock = cms.untracked.uint32(1),
0035 numberEventsInLuminosityBlock = cms.untracked.uint32(3),
0036 firstEvent = cms.untracked.uint32(1),
0037 firstRun = cms.untracked.uint32(310),
0038 numberEventsInRun = cms.untracked.uint32(12)
0039 )
0040
0041 process.maxEvents = cms.untracked.PSet(
0042 input = cms.untracked.int32(1000)
0043 )
0044
0045 process.prod = cms.EDAnalyzer("EfficiencyByLabelAnalyzer")
0046
0047 process.p = cms.Path(process.prod)
0048